About Valley Emmaus Community
The Valley Emmaus Community is an ecumenical organization composed of individuals in the Rio Grande Valley who have completed the Walk to Emmaus.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Harlingen?

Understanding the cost of living near Harlingen is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Valley Emmaus Community.
Harlingen's Cost of Living Index is approximately 77.2 (22.8% less expensive than US average; 17.0% less than TX average). Rio Grande Valley city, very affordable. Valley Metro. When planning your budget based on a salary from Valley Emmaus Community,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$700 - $1,000+ A significant portion of Valley Emmaus Community sal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$160 - $260 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ation Limited local transit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$350 - $520 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$280 - $550+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$340 - $630+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$1,860 - $2,960+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
